Scheduling Coordinator
The University of Arkansas for Medical Sciences (UAMS) is a collaborative health care organization focused on improving patient care. The Scheduling Coordinator role involves counseling patients on their schedules, coordinating with financial teams, and ensuring proper scheduling and financial clearance for procedures.

Responsibilities
Schedules, reschedules, and coordinates appointments using hospital software by performing visit notifications to patients and inputting/updating accurate patient information. Works patient depot and maintains snap board for endoscopy. Schedules tests, issues prep instructions, and mails out no-show letters. Blocks schedules in EPIC as appropriate
Remains committed to the Circle of Excellence to provide patient care and support in achieving the overall mission of the organization
Verifies Insurance and explains benefits. Enters scheduling criteria, collaborates with the authorization team to determine benefit and authorization information
Qualification
Required
High school graduate, GED, or formal education equivalent plus (7) seven years of training and/or experience in business office administration, customer service, or related work of which three years' experience is in patient registration, scheduling, or billing in a healthcare environment OR
Bachelor's degree plus three years' experience in patient registration, scheduling, or billing in a healthcare environment
